Silymarin and its major constituent, Silibinin, are extracts from the medicinal plant Silybum marianum (milk thistle) and have traditionally been used for the treatment of liver diseases. Recently, these orally active, flavonoid agents have also been shown to exert significant anti-neoplastic effects in a variety of in vitro and in vivo cancer models, including skin, breast, lung, colon, bladder, prostate and kidney carcinomas. The aim of the present review is to examine the pharmacokinetics, mechanisms, effectiveness and adverse effects of silibinin's anti-cancer actions reported to date in pre-clinical and clinical trials. The review will also discuss the results of current research efforts seeking to determine the extent to which the effectiveness of silibinin as an adjunct cancer treatment is influenced by such factors as histologic subtype, hormonal status, stromal interactions and drug metabolising gene polymorphisms. The results of these studies may help to more precisely target and dose silibinin therapy to optimise clinical outcomes for oncology patients.

An elevated C-reactive protein (CRP) has recently been shown to be strongly predictive of mortality in hemodialysis patients. However, its predictive value in peritoneal dialysis (PD) patients has not been assessed. A cohort of 50 PD patients was followed prospectively for a 3-yr period, after initial determination of CRP. Patients with an elevated CRP (>6 mg/L; n = 29) had significantly reduced plasma prealbumin (0.36 +/- 0.02 versus 0.44 +/- 0.03 g/L; P: < 0.05), decreased total weekly creatinine clearance (C(Cr); 52.5 +/- 2.3 versus 63.1 +/- 3.2 L/1.73 m(2); P: < 0.01), and increased left ventricular thickness (1.24 +/- 0.05 versus 1.08 +/- 0.06 cm; P: < 0.05) at baseline compared with those who had a normal CRP (< or =6 mg/L; n = 21). Baseline CRP (log-transformed) correlated weakly with baseline Kt/V, C(Cr), and pre-albumin. With the use of a multivariate Cox's proportional hazards model to adjust for potential confounding factors, an elevated CRP was predictive of myocardial infarction (adjusted hazard ratio, 4.8; 95% confidence interval [CI], 1.0 to 23; P: = 0.048) and tended to be predictive of fatal myocardial infarction (adjusted hazard ratio, 6.0; 95% CI, 0.8 to 43; P: = 0.07). However, CRP was not significantly associated with all-cause mortality (adjusted hazard ratio, 2.1; 95% CI,0.8 to 5.4; P: = 0.15). In conclusion, CRP elevation occurs in a substantial proportion of PD patients and is independently predictive of future myocardial infarction. Such patients may warrant closer monitoring and attention to modifiable cardiovascular risk factors.
